Abstract

Various methods and apparatus are described in for a wireless access point. The wireless access point allows access to a wireless LAN that has two or more service set identifiers (SSIDs). At least one of the SSIDs is associated with a public wireless LAN. The wireless access point implements a segmentation policy that 1) provides unimpeded access to a Wide Area network through the public wireless LAN based on a first type of application or a first type of device detected by the wireless access point and 2) restricts access to the Wide Area network through the public wireless LAN by requiring an authorization check to access the Wide Area network based on detecting a second type of application.

Claims (63)

1. A method, comprising:

establishing communication with a wireless device configured with a network identifier, the wireless device comprising a class of wireless device having a class of wireless application;

detecting the class of wireless device and the class of wireless application;

classifying the class of wireless device and the class of wireless application, in respect to each other, as a first category, wherein the first category comprises a narrowband device with a resident narrowband application; and

providing a first class of access to a network to the first category.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ein providing the first class of network access comprises providing access to a wide area network (WAN).

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ein providing the first class of network access comprises providing access to a plurality of resources on a local area network (LAN).

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the narrowband device is one of a personal digital assistant and a cellular telephone device.

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the narrowband application is one of an email application and a voice application, resident on a narrowband wireless device.

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ein detecting the class of wireless device comprises reading one of a media access control (MAC) address of the wireless device and an electronic serial number of the wireless device.

7. The method of claim 1 , wherein detecting the class of wireless application comprises detecting the data protocol of the wireless application.

8. The method of claim 7 , wherein the data protocol is voice over IP (VoIP) protocol.

9. The method of claim 1 wherein detecting the class of wireless application comprises matching a destination IP address requested by the wireless application with a list of service providers.
